The show starts with the Wardlow and Christian Cage, this was straight to the point and I liked it. No more to say and the stip is for sure a ladder match between this two.
Orange Cassidy & Darby Allin vs Big Bill & Lee Moriarty (***3/4) Big Bill and Lee Moriarty are such a tremendous midcard tag team and Orange teaming with Darby is always a fun time. Great stuff.
Sammy Guevara with a squash and a promo that was okay. FTR and Jarret & Lethal segment that personally was funny.
Toni Storm & Ruby Soho vs Hikaru Shida & Britt Baker (***1/4) Very good fast paced match that delivered with getting Shida over in her comeback as well of getting Storm a win. Hopefully that match is with a stipulation.
Roderick Strong vs Chris Jericho in a Falls Count Anywhere match (****1/4) This brawling in all over the arena type of match in AEW always hits, and boy this delivered the goods. Roddy Strong and Jericho worked STIFF that mixed amazingly with the usual goofiness of this type of matches in AEW. TREMENDOUS.
Jack Perry vs Rush (****) Rush is an animal that should be pushed/rewarded and with Andrade back hopefully he is in important matches. Jack Perry as the bloodied babyface surviving is his perfect type of match and Rush is perfect in that role.
Jay White vs Ricky Starks (***3/4) Personally I think this match was going GREAT with reversals, big moves and pins been kicked out at 2.99 and because I have watched a shit ton of Attitude Era matches, this was basically one and even had that kind of finish. We will see what they will do at the PPV but I need them with a microphone to heat up their match at DoN.
Don Callis entered the ring with the crowd booing the shit out of him, then the BCC attacked Omega but he had the Bucks backup but didn´t stopped. Hangman FUCKING Page is BACK with an eye patch looking like a bad ass and The Elite finally reunites and the match at DoN will be in the Anarchy in the Arena stip, BOYS we are in for a CLASSIC.
Rating of the Show: 8.5/10
The first hour was mid and I would say filled with the things that have felt out of place but the second hour is AEW at his best (Except the DQ) with tremendous creative matches that feel like only AEW can do in TV. Three back to back killer matches and an amazing angle to close one of the best episodes of AEW Dynamite this year.
